Description:

This is the 'ksm' subpackage of 'qemu' SRPM, split out into its own package.
The  canonical version of this code has always been fedora dist-git in
qemu.git, but it has its own upstream repo now. The history is documented a bit
more here: https://github.com/ksmtuned/ksmtuned/blob/master/HISTORY

As such it needs to obsolete the ksm package. I will update the Obsoletes
versioning to match latest qemu rawhide version+1, before the first koji build.

Description from the RPM: Kernel Samepage Merging (KSM) is a memory-saving
de-duplication feature, that merges anonymous (private) pages (not pagecache
ones).

This package provides service files for disabling (ksm) and tuning (ksmtuned)
